
Quick No-Yeast Cinnamon Rolls
60% authentic · American
A simplified version of classic cinnamon rolls, using a quick biscuit-like dough that doesn't require yeast or rising time, perfect for a speedy treat.

Ingredients
- All-purpose flour2 cups
- Baking powder2 teaspoons
- Granulated sugar1/4 cup
- Salt1/2 teaspoon
- Cold unsalted butter, cut into cubes1/2 cup
- Milk1/2 cup
- Brown sugar, packed1/2 cup
- Ground cinnamon1 tablespoon
- Powdered sugar1 cup
- Milk or cream2-3 tablespoons
Steps
- 1
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Grease a baking dish.
- 2
In a large b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, granulated sugar, and salt.
- 3
Cut in the cold butter using a pastry blender or your fingers until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
- 4
Stir in the milk until just combined to form a soft dough.
- 5
On a lightly floured surface, pat or gently roll the dough into a rectangle (about 8x10 inches).
- 6
In a small bowl, mix together brown sugar and cinnamon.
- 7
S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mixture evenly over the dough.
- 8
Roll up the dough tightly from one long side.
- 9
Cut the roll into 8 slices.
- 10
Place slices cut-side up in the prepared baking dish.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until golden brown.
- 11
While rolls bake, whisk together powdered sugar and milk/cream to create a glaze.
- 12
Drizzle the glaze over the warm rolls.
